Redirection aprés l'authentification
jaafar
Messages postés
3
Date d'inscription
Statut
Membre
Dernière intervention
-
jaafar Messages postés 3 Date d'inscription Statut Membre Dernière intervention -
jaafar Messages postés 3 Date d'inscription Statut Membre Dernière intervention -
salut j'ai crée un code pour la session tout ça marche mais le probléme j'ai eu quelque souci comment le rediriger a la page accueil voila mon code
<?php
session_start();
echo"<h1>Connexion</h1>";
if(isset($_POST['submit']))
{
$username=htmlspecialchars(trim($_POST['username']));
$password=htmlspecialchars(trim($_POST['password']));
if($username&&$password)
{
$password=md5($password);
$connect=mysql_connect('localhost','root','');
mysql_select_db('smart');
$log=mysql_query("select * from membres where pseudo='$username'and pass ='$password'");
$rows=mysql_num_rows($log);
if($rows==1)
{ while($row=mysql_fetch_assoc($log))
{$active=$row['active'];
}
if($active==1)
{
$_SESSION['pseudo']=$username;
header("location:membre.php");
}else die("votre compte n'est pas active,consultez votre e-mail");
}else echo"nom d'utlisateur ou mots de passe incorect";
}else echo"veuillez saisir les champs";
}
?>
<form method="post" action="login.php"/>
<p>votre nom d'utlisateur</p>
<input type="text" name="username"/>
<p>Password</p>
<input type="password" name="password"/><br/><br/>
<input type="submit" value="valider" name="submit"/>
</form>
<?php
session_start();
echo"<h1>Connexion</h1>";
if(isset($_POST['submit']))
{
$username=htmlspecialchars(trim($_POST['username']));
$password=htmlspecialchars(trim($_POST['password']));
if($username&&$password)
{
$password=md5($password);
$connect=mysql_connect('localhost','root','');
mysql_select_db('smart');
$log=mysql_query("select * from membres where pseudo='$username'and pass ='$password'");
$rows=mysql_num_rows($log);
if($rows==1)
{ while($row=mysql_fetch_assoc($log))
{$active=$row['active'];
}
if($active==1)
{
$_SESSION['pseudo']=$username;
header("location:membre.php");
}else die("votre compte n'est pas active,consultez votre e-mail");
}else echo"nom d'utlisateur ou mots de passe incorect";
}else echo"veuillez saisir les champs";
}
?>
<form method="post" action="login.php"/>
<p>votre nom d'utlisateur</p>
<input type="text" name="username"/>
<p>Password</p>
<input type="password" name="password"/><br/><br/>
<input type="submit" value="valider" name="submit"/>
</form>
A voir également:
- Redirection aprés l'authentification
- Double authentification google - Guide
- Désactiver l'authentification à deux facteurs instagram sans se connecter ✓ - Forum Instagram
- Avertissement de redirection ✓ - Forum MacOS
- Firfox 3 et option de redirection (désactiver ✓ - Forum Logiciels
- Code a 6 chiffres application d'authentification instagram - Forum Instagram
1 réponse
Bonjour, il faut mettre normalement
"Un homme azerty en vaut deux"
header("Location: acceuil.php");
"Un homme azerty en vaut deux"
@lobotomix:~# rm -rf *\
Messages postés
1392
Date d'inscription
Statut
Membre
Dernière intervention
208
ha désolé ça doit pas être ça je viens de voir que vous connaissez déjà
@lobotomix:~# rm -rf *\
Messages postés
1392
Date d'inscription
Statut
Membre
Dernière intervention
208
je n'en doute mais voila le meilleur moyen de rediriger vers la page acceuil non?
jaafar
Messages postés
3
Date d'inscription
Statut
Membre
Dernière intervention
non ça ne marche car dans la page membre contient l'affichage d'utilisateur